excel提取ctrl e怎么没反应

excel提取ctrl e怎么没反应

Excel提取Ctrl + E没反应的原因、如何解决、替代方法

Excel中的Ctrl + E功能,通常称为“Flash Fill”或“快速填充”,是一个非常强大的工具,能够帮助用户自动识别和填充基于样本的模式。然而,有时候这个功能可能会失效,下面我们将详细探讨其原因以及解决方法。可能的原因包括功能未启用、软件版本不支持、数据输入不正确等。以下将详细讨论其中一个原因:功能未启用。

功能未启用

有时候,Excel的快速填充功能可能因为某些原因被禁用了。要确保该功能已启用,请按照以下步骤操作:

  1. 打开Excel,点击左上角的“文件”菜单。
  2. 选择“选项”,然后在弹出的窗口中选择“高级”。
  3. 在“高级”选项卡中,向下滚动到“自动化”部分,确保“启用快速填充”选项被选中。
  4. 点击“确定”保存更改。

通过以上步骤,可以确保快速填充功能已启用。如果问题依然存在,可以尝试其他解决方法。

一、确认软件版本和更新

不同版本的Excel在功能上可能有所差异,确保使用的是支持快速填充功能的版本非常重要。

1.1 检查软件版本

要检查当前使用的Excel版本,请按照以下步骤操作:

  1. 打开Excel。
  2. 点击左上角的“文件”菜单。
  3. 选择“账户”或“帮助”,查看当前的Excel版本信息。

1.2 更新Excel

如果发现当前的Excel版本较旧,可以尝试更新到最新版本。更新步骤如下:

  1. 打开Excel。
  2. 点击左上角的“文件”菜单。
  3. 选择“账户”,然后点击“更新选项”。
  4. 选择“立即更新”并等待更新完成。

二、数据输入格式正确性

快速填充功能依赖于用户输入的数据样本。如果输入的数据格式不正确,快速填充功能可能无法正常工作。

2.1 样本数据

确保样本数据具有一致性和可识别的模式。例如,如果要提取姓名中的首字母,可以先手动输入几个样本:

姓名 首字母
张三 ZS
李四 LS

然后在第三行的“首字母”列中使用Ctrl + E,Excel将自动填充剩余的数据。

2.2 数据范围

确保数据输入的范围正确无误。如果数据范围过大或过小,可能会导致快速填充功能无法识别。

三、Excel设置调整

某些Excel设置可能会影响快速填充功能的正常使用。

3.1 自动计算

确保Excel的自动计算功能已启用。可以按照以下步骤检查:

  1. 打开Excel。
  2. 点击“公式”选项卡。
  3. 在“计算选项”组中,确保选择“自动”。

3.2 语言设置

有时候语言设置也会影响快速填充功能。确保Excel的语言设置与系统语言一致。

四、替代方法

如果上述方法均无法解决问题,可以尝试其他替代方法。

4.1 使用公式

可以使用Excel公式实现类似快速填充的效果。例如,要提取姓名中的首字母,可以使用以下公式:

=LEFT(A2,1) & LEFT(A2,SEARCH(" ",A2)+1,1)

将公式应用于所有目标单元格,可以实现类似快速填充的效果。

4.2 使用VBA宏

如果需要更复杂的功能,可以编写VBA宏来实现。以下是一个简单的示例:

Sub ExtractInitials()

Dim rng As Range

Dim cell As Range

Set rng = Selection

For Each cell In rng

cell.Offset(0, 1).Value = Left(cell.Value, 1) & Mid(cell.Value, InStr(1, cell.Value, " ") + 1, 1)

Next cell

End Sub

在Excel中按Alt + F11打开VBA编辑器,插入新模块并粘贴上述代码。运行宏后,可以实现快速填充的效果。

五、其他常见问题与解决方案

5.1 快速填充功能灰色

有时候快速填充功能可能会显示为灰色,无法使用。这通常是因为选中的单元格区域不正确。

  1. 确保选中的是单个单元格,而不是整个列或行。
  2. 确保选中的单元格在数据范围内。

5.2 数据类型不匹配

快速填充功能对数据类型有一定要求。例如,如果尝试在数字和文本之间进行填充,可能会失败。确保数据类型一致。

5.3 重启Excel

有时候,简单的重启Excel可以解决很多问题。关闭Excel并重新打开,尝试再次使用快速填充功能。

5.4 修复Office

如果问题依然存在,可以尝试修复Office。步骤如下:

  1. 打开“控制面板”。
  2. 选择“程序和功能”。
  3. 找到Microsoft Office,右键选择“更改”。
  4. 选择“修复”并按照提示完成操作。

六、用户案例分享

6.1 案例一:姓名首字母提取

某公司HR需要提取员工姓名的首字母,但快速填充功能无法使用。经过检查,发现是因为Excel版本过旧。更新到最新版本后,问题解决。

6.2 案例二:日期格式转换

某财务人员需要将日期从一种格式转换为另一种格式,但快速填充功能无法识别。通过手动输入几个样本数据后,快速填充功能正常工作。

七、总结

Excel中的Ctrl + E快速填充功能非常强大,但有时候可能会遇到各种问题。通过检查功能启用状态、软件版本、数据输入格式和Excel设置,可以解决大部分问题。如果问题依然存在,可以尝试使用公式或VBA宏实现类似功能。希望本文能帮助大家更好地利用Excel,提高工作效率。

相关问答FAQs:

1. 为什么我在Excel中按下Ctrl+E键没有任何反应?
通常情况下,按下Ctrl+E键可以用来提取数据,但如果你按下这个组合键却没有反应,可能有以下几个原因:

  • 快捷键冲突: 首先,请确认你没有安装任何与Excel冲突的软件。有些软件可能会占用Ctrl+E键,导致Excel无法正确响应。你可以尝试关闭其他程序,然后再次尝试按下Ctrl+E键。
  • 工作表被锁定: 其次,请检查你当前的工作表是否被锁定。如果工作表被锁定,你可能无法使用Ctrl+E键进行提取操作。你可以右键单击工作表标签,选择“解锁工作表”来解除锁定。
  • 键盘布局问题: 另外,请确保你使用的是正确的键盘布局。有些键盘布局可能会导致Ctrl+E键无效。你可以尝试切换到标准键盘布局,然后再次尝试按下Ctrl+E键。

如果以上方法都没有解决你的问题,我建议你尝试使用其他方式来提取数据,比如使用函数或者宏。你可以在Excel的帮助文档中查找更多关于数据提取的方法和技巧。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4907201

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部